app-settings-0.2.0.6: tests/Tests.hs

{-# LANGUAGE ScopedTypeVariables #-}

import Data.AppSettings
import Data.AppSettingsInternal

import Test.Hspec
import Test.HUnit (assertBool, assertEqual)

import System.Directory (removeFile, copyFile, doesFileExist)
import Control.Exception (try, SomeException)

textSizeFromWidth :: Setting Double
textSizeFromWidth = Setting "textSizeFromWidth" 0.04

textFill :: Setting (Double,Double,Double,Double)
textFill = Setting "textFill" (1, 1, 0, 1)

textSizeFromHeight :: Setting Double
textSizeFromHeight = Setting "textSizeFromHeight" 12.4

testInlineList :: Setting [String]
testInlineList = Setting "testInlineList" ["inline1", "inline2", "inline3"]

testList :: Setting [String]
testList = ListSetting "testList" ["list1", "list2", "list3"]

defaultConfig :: DefaultConfig
defaultConfig = getDefaultConfig $ do
    setting textSizeFromWidth
    setting textSizeFromHeight
    setting textFill
    setting testInlineList
    setting testList

main :: IO ()
main = hspec $ do
    describe "unit tests" testIsKeyForListSetting
    describe "load config" $ do
        testEmptyFileDefaults
        testPartialFileDefaults
        testPartialFileDefaults2
        testFileWithComments
        testInvalidFile
        testInvalidValue
        testNonExistingFile
        testReadLongSetting
    describe "save config" $ do
        testSaveUserSetAndDefaults
        createBakBeforeSaving
        wrapLongSettings
    describe "set setting" testSetListSetting
